Profile
QueryPie Inc. was founded as a response to the increasing global demand for compliance with privacy laws, viewing it as an opportunity to impact the market positively. Established in Silicon Valley in 2017, QueryPie offers a unified cybersecurity solution designed to enhance the access control and audit for infrastructure.
While the market challenge may be intricate, QueryPie believes the solution should be straightforward. Our mission is to provide businesses with easy and secure problem-solving data protection tools.
QueryPie consolidates databases, servers, and Kubernetes clusters both on-premises and in multi-cloud environments. By centralizing data storage and access points, QueryPie increases visibility and security, facilitating the use of data for AI applications.
QueryPie addresses these challenges by providing a comprehensive solution that centralizes database management, enhances security, and simplifies compliance. By leveraging QueryPie, organizations can reduce the risk of data breaches, improve operational efficiency, and maintain compliance with evolving data protection regulations.

Key Products
QueryPie DAC(Database Access Controller): QueryPie DAC that manages and regulates access to a database, ensuring that only authorized users or applications can access specific data or perform certain operations. They are critical for maintaining the security, integrity, and confidentiality of data stored in databases.
QueryPie SAC(System Access Controller): QueryPie SAC manages and regulates access to computing systems, ensuring that only authorized users or processes can access system resources, such as files, applications, and network services. These controllers are essential for maintaining the security and integrity of computer systems.
QueryPie KAC (Kubernetes Access Controller): QueryPie KAC is a critical component responsible for enforcing access control policies within a Kubernetes cluster. It provides users with K8s access control, integrated audit logging, and a unified management environment for assets of other systems.
QueryPie WAC (Web Application Access Controller): QueryPie WAC provides an integrated access control environment that allows you to manage not only DB, System, and Cluster resources, but also numerous scattered web applications in one place. You can apply consistent security policies to various types of web applications and ensure insufficient security visibility through detailed user activity recording.
QueryPie AIDD (AI-powered Data Discovery): AIDD automatically identifies and classifies sensitive information, generating tags that can be applied for access control. It ensures that data is not only accessible but also meaningful and actionable.
Key Executives
Brant Hwang, Chief Executive Officer & Founder
Brant is the CEO & Founder of QueryPie Inc., an innovative cybersecurity solution startup known for its streamlined access control and audit solutions for infrastructures. Brant has a strong background in the technology scene, having previously served as a software developer at Kakao, Korea’s leading platform and search engine company. He is a well-known figure for his proactive business management approaches and persistent entrepreneurial spirit since the foundation of QueryPie.
Paul Hong, Chief Financial Officer & Co-founder
Paul has been developing the company’s legal and financial management strategy as a co-founder of QueryPie Inc. Also as the legal counsel of QueryPie, he helped establish QueryPie’s US Headquarters after being selected as a Y Combinator alumni and securing a $17.75 million preferred seed round in 2021. Paul had worked as legal team manager at Korean Airline after shifting his career from airplane engineering to lawyer before joining QueryPie.
Kris Park, Chief Strategy Officer
Kris is responsible for QueryPie’s global business strategy, including corporate management, sales, and investor relationships. With over 25 years of experience in business development and management, he is an active pioneer in the flourishing platform, e-commerce, and insure-tech businesses. Kris is also a former business strategy consultant at Accenture.
Kenny Park, Chief Information Security Officer
Kenny is a notable figure in the field of cybersecurity with over 20 years of experience. As the CISO, he played a crucial role in shaping QueryPie’s information security strategies and data governance and delving into enriching QueryPie’s cybersecurity solution portfolio from database, system, Kubernetes, web application and further more. He contributes to guiding compliance strategic direction and supporting its maturation in the cybersecurity industry.
Sam Kim, Chief Technology Officer
Sam leads all aspects of QueryPie solutions’ technological aspects, including technical talent development and operations. He is responsible for creating an exceptional user experience seamlessly and sustainably. Sam has been with Kakao, a leading platform/ search engine/and mobile commerce tech company, for more than 20 years and has held various technical leadership roles, contributing to the company’s significant changes and critical initiatives before joining QueryPie.

Competitors
Teleport: Teleport provides on-demand, least-privileged access to your infrastructure, on a foundation of cryptographic identity and zero trust, with built-in identity and policy governance.
CyberArk: CyberArk provides a comprehensive approach to Identity Security centered on privileged access management to protect against advanced cyber threats.
StrongDM: StrongDM develops an infrastructure access platform which helps organizations manage and audit access to their databases, servers, clusters, and web applications.

In today’s landscape, modern applications are often structured using microservice architectures (MSA) and distributed across multiple databases and cloud platforms. This complexity makes it challenging for organizations to maintain a clear understanding of the personal data they possess, where it is stored across different environments, and how it is managed. These challenges can result in compliance violations and large-scale data breaches, jeopardizing trust, raising legal concerns, and threatening operational continuity.
To address these issues, organizations must consistently monitor and assess their data, ensuring proper user authorization. By adhering to these practices, they can mitigate a significant portion of threats to their IT assets.
